How to Join
-
Club timetables and sign-up forms are shared with parents at the start of each term.
-
All clubs, except Digital Leaders, are allocated on a first-come, first-served basis (with waiting lists if needed).
-
Digital Leaders is by application only – children who are interested will be asked to complete a short application to demonstrate their commitment and interest.
-
Clubs are run by school staff
-
Cost: Clubs are free;
-
Times: Most after-school clubs finish by 4:30pm.
-
Collection: Please ensure your child is collected promptly from the agreed location.
-
Commitment: We encourage children to attend regularly once enrolled.
